Neurofeedback is a type of biofeedback that uses real-time displays of your brain activity (measured with EEG, or electroencephalography) to teach you how to regulate your brainwaves. Think of it like holding up a mirror to your mind. When you can see how your brain is behaving, you can learn to guide it into healthier patterns.
How Does Neurofeedback Work?
Your brain is constantly producing electrical activity—different “brainwaves” that reflect your mental state. For example:
- Beta waves: Associated with alertness, problem-solving, and sometimes anxiety.
- Alpha waves: Linked to relaxation and calm focus.
- Theta waves: Connected with creativity, intuition, and deep relaxation.
- Delta waves: The slow waves of deep, restorative sleep.
Neurofeedback devices pick up on these signals and give you feedback through sound, visuals, or even games. For instance, if your mind is racing and you bring it back to a calm state, the device may reward you with soothing audio or a visual cue. Over time, your brain learns what “calm and focused” feels like, and it becomes easier to access that state on your own.

Why People Use Neurofeedback
People turn to neurofeedback for all kinds of reasons, including:
- Reducing stress and anxiety
- Improving focus and attention
- Supporting better sleep
- Boosting meditation and mindfulness practices
- Enhancing overall mental performance
